Supply chain award

Dudley’s Aluminium has been awarded the Overall Partner Award at the Willmott Dixon Supply Chain Awards.

Dudley’s Aluminium was awarded the accolade for its work to date and, more recently, the Taff Vale Redevelopment, a large window and curtain walling package.

The Taff Vale Redevelopment is a £38 million project which, upon completion, will be made up of offices and leisure facilities, including a gym and a library. The site of the redevelopment is based at the heart of Pontypridd and will provide opportunities for Rhondda Cynon Taf and the south east Wales Region. Ongoing developments on this project have helped Dudley’s Aluminium to secure this award.

The Supply Chain Awards celebrate the partners of Willmott Dixon and highlight their successes. In a video played before the announcement of the Overall Partner Award, Dudley’s Aluminium was praised by Dave John, senior operations manager at Wilmott Dixon for its professionalism, honesty, and performance in design and on site, all of which were described as exceptional.

Colin Shorney, managing director of Dudley’s Aluminium, said: “Our whole team – from design through to procurement, production and site installation – work extremely hard and it’s their continued dedication to each project that has played a large part in Dudley’s receiving this award. We look forward to completion of the Taff Vale project and are excited to see what’s next.”
